Restoration and management of the Mesnil-sous-Jumièges marsh in the Seine Maritime

April 28, 2019 FACE

The commune of Mesnil-sous-Jumièges and the Fédération Départementale des Chasseurs de Seine Maritime have established a partnership for the restoration and preservation of the communal marshland. The Federation has undertaken an ecological inventory, including an examination of the flora and habitats present.

The site hosts a very diverse fauna, including a rich birdlife. The meadows will be maintained in partnership with the Parc Naturel Régional des Boucles de la Seine Normande. Ponds will be created to provide a site for aquatic fauna with the financial support of the Seine Normandy Water Agency.

Site visits for the general public will be organized.
